Amazon to invest up to $4 billion in AI startup Anthropic, known for its Claude chatbot
Microsoft holds a $13 billion investment in OpenAI, making it a leader in generative AI technology
Amazon's investment in Anthropic signals its participation in the growing AI arms race
Anthropic's Claude AI model can revise its own responses, claiming greater safety without human moderation
Claude and Claude 2 chatbots by Anthropic can translate text, write code, and answer questions, rivaling ChatGPT and Google's Bard
Anthropic's model is guided by principles, allowing autonomous response revision
Claude excels in handling larger prompts, making it suitable for extensive document analysis
Amazon gains minority ownership of Anthropic, planning to integrate its technology into various products, including Amazon Bedrock
Amazon's custom chips will support Anthropic in building, training, and deploying AI models, with AWS as the primary cloud provider
The deal represents a significant investment, potentially reaching $4 billion, marking a major milestone for Amazon Web Services (AWS)
